Abstract

The invention relates to a pipe slotting machine used for machining automobile air-conditioning pipes. The pipe slotting machine comprises a lower rack, an upper rack, a pipe driving mechanism arranged on the lower rack, and cutter driving mechanisms arranged on the upper rack. The pipe driving mechanism is composed of a row of belt pulleys arranged on the outer end surface of one lower beam, driving belt pulleys driving the belt pulleys through belts, the machining pipes arranged between the lower beams, and fixing sleeves penetrating the two ends of the machining pipes. The upper end surfaces of upper beams are tooth-shaped surfaces. Each cutter driving mechanism is composed of a pipe slotting knife, an adjusting rod connected to the handle of the pipe slotting knife, a horizontal sliding block connected to the upper end of the adjusting rod, two horizontal rods penetrating the horizontal sliding block, and gears connected to the two ends of the horizontal rods. According to the invention, the machining pipes can be conveniently installed and can be machined in batch only by one time, the machining adjustment is convenient, the production efficiency is improved, design changes can be rapidly dealt with, and high-speed production remands can be met.

Background technology
To in pipe carries out annular groove processing in prior art, general is all by tube grip by scroll chuck, then rotated along its central shaft by driven by motor pipe, then by chip cutters such as lathe tools, tube surface is processed with carrying out annular groove, this processing mode compares limitation, processing work installs difficulty, and time processing can only be processed single tubular, the processing of once batch can not be realized, and pipe fitting cell body Working position regulates difficulty, bring a lot of inconvenience to processing, process flexibility is poor, and production efficiency is low.

As Figure 1-4, the present invention relates to a kind of air conditioning for automobiles pipe fitting processing tube seat machine, comprise lower bearing bracket 1, upper spider 5, the cutter drives mechanism being arranged on the pipe fitting driving mechanism on lower bearing bracket 1 and being arranged on upper spider 5, described lower bearing bracket 1 is the two underbeam bodies be arranged in parallel, and pipe fitting driving mechanism is by the row's drive pulley 2 being arranged on the external end face of a underbeam, through the driving pulley 3 of belt drive drive pulley 2, be arranged on the processing pipe fitting 13 between underbeam body, form with the fixing pipe box 14 of processing pipe fitting 13 both ends cross-under, described upper spider 5 is the two upper beam bodies be arranged in parallel, and the upper surface of upper beam body is toothed surface 7, described cutter drives mechanism is by tube seat cutter 11, the adjusting rod 9 be connected with the handle of a knife of tube seat cutter 11, connect the horizontal slip block 18 of rod end on adjusting rod 9, two horizon bars 17 of cross-under horizontal slip block 18, the gear 8 be connected with horizon bar 17 both ends forms, described gear 8 engages with the toothed surface 7 of upper beam body upper end, the side of described lower bearing bracket 1 connects finished product delivery outlet 12, described upper spider 5 is set in parallel in the top of lower bearing bracket 1, described cutter drives mechanism is provided with several at upper spider 5, described driving pulley 3 is connected with the rotating shaft of the first drive motors 4, described drive pulley 2 is fixedly connected with the fixing pipe box 14 of cross-under on the side underbeam body of lower bearing bracket 1, described fixing pipe box 14 is flexibly connected with the underbeam body of lower bearing bracket 1 by bearing, and fixing pipe box 14 is arranged the screwing bolts 16 of fixing processing pipe fitting 13, the bottom bar portion of described adjusting rod 9 arranges the spliced eye 15 of the handle of a knife connecting tube seat cutter 11, and the handle of a knife junction of adjusting rod 9 lower end and tube seat cutter 11 arranges tightening nut 10, described horizontal slip block 18 is driven by motor and moves on horizon bar 17, described horizon bar 17 1 end arranges the second drive motors 6, the rotating shaft of described second drive motors 6 connects gear 8, the other end of horizon bar 17 arranges the contiguous block 19 connecting gear 8, described second drive motors 6 drives cutter drives mechanism to move along upper spider 5.
In sum, when the present invention uses, processing pipe fitting 13 is entered lower bearing bracket 1 from fixing pipe box 14 cross-under of the Liang Tishang of lower bearing bracket 1 side, and one end of processing pipe fitting 13 is connected with the fixing pipe box 14 of the Liang Tishang of lower bearing bracket 1 opposite side, and by screwing bolts 16, processing pipe fitting 13 is fixed, make processing pipe fitting 13 parallel stationary arrangement between lower bearing bracket 1 in a row, then the first drive motors 4 by connecting belt pulley drives processing pipe fitting 13 to rotate, then the height by regulating tightening nut 10 to regulate tube seat cutter 11, determine the cell body degree of depth that pipe fitting is processed, then horizontal slip block 18 position on horizon bar 17 is regulated, regulate the position of pipe fitting working groove on pipe fitting, cutter drives mechanism is driven to move along upper spider 5 by the second drive motors 6, realize the processing of tube seat cutter 11 to the surperficial cell body of processing pipe fitting 13, wherein cutter drives mechanism is provided with several at upper spider, processing pipe fitting 13 is easy for installation, realize processing a batch machining of pipe fitting simultaneously, and the Working position of pipe fitting is easy to adjust, and the needs of design variation and high-speed production can be tackled fast, achieve High-efficient Production, high-quality speed-raising one times is processed incessantly to the cell body of whole air conditioning for automobiles pipe fitting, change the machine tooling of the pipe of scroll chuck clamping in the past.
